Product

PERSONA (TM) The Personalized Knee System Tibial General Instrument Tray, non-sterile The intended use of the sterilization case is to organize, store and protect its contents from damage consistent with typical hospital or surgical center circulation (i.e. between central services and the operating room) and during transport between a Zimmer distributorship and a health care facility by Zimmer distributorship personnel.

Reason

The firm discovered that the current Personal Tibial/General Fixed Bracket Trays may not have the specific geometry to accommodate the tibial drill and stop guide with proper position/orientation. The drill bracket and drill guide are not the correct geometry to allow for a proper fit in the Persona Fixed Case Kit which could lead to improper sterilization of the tibial drill and stop guide.
